CRM 2013 - Quote Products Inline Edit View

Question
-
I attemped to change the columns in the "Quote Products Inline Edit View", but it is not customizable. The View editor does however allow you to "Save As" when you make changes, so I saved my customised view and modified the Quote Form to use my new view.
The column headers appear as expected, but the Product Name no longer shows values. I presume this is because it has to do some custom logic to determine whether to display the existing product name or the write-in Product Name.
Would I be correct in assuming the following:
1) Being able to create Quote Product views is not intended to be possible. (There is no "New" button when you view the Quote Product Views in a solution)
2) There is no way for me to customise this view or create my own view to replace the default one so that I can for example remove the "Discount" column from the default "Quote Product Inline Edit View".If so then it looks like I will have to investigate replacing Quote Products entirely with my own custom entity and replicating much of the default functionality.

There isn't any supported way at the moment to change the views used in the editable grids. It is bound to the out of the box view. When you open the Inline Edit view you'll probably notice a little message indicating the ability to customize the view has been "limited" - which is a nice way of saying you can't change it at all :)

Hi Guys,
I was having the same problem, and came up with this neat workaround. It appears the problem is just with the first column in the new view, so I added and unused field column (I used Description as it was blank) and set it as the first column with a minimum width of 25, leaving the product Name as the second column and it then starts working again...
